> > OK. Now you have to activate the library to connect PHP to PostgreSQL,
> > this is in the php.ini file. In Windows 2000 it is in the following
> > folders: C:\WINNT and in the PHP installation folder, in my case:
> > C:\AppServ\php. Once you find this file you have to discomment this
> > extension: extension=php_pgsql.dll, to do that you are going to erase the
> > ";" at the beggining of the line.
